4. Visual understanding

Read this diagram top to bottom — it is the mental model for App Service Plans Explained.

SKU (F1/B1/S1/P1v3)
   = CPU + RAM + features
        │
   One plan → many web apps (cost shares)
        │
   Scale up = bigger VM size
   Scale out = more instances

8. Try this (Azure CLI / tools)

Use an Azure lab or free subscription. Prefer Azure CLI or Portal. Delete idle App Service plans, SQL databases, and AKS clusters when practice is done.

az appservice plan create -g rg-cloudverse-dev -n plan-cloudverse-dev --sku B1 --is-linux
az appservice plan show -g rg-cloudverse-dev -n plan-cloudverse-dev -o table

10. Best practices checklist

  • Use naming: rg- / app- / plan- / kv- prefixes with env suffix.
  • Tag every RG: project=cloudverse, env=dev|test|prod.
  • Prefer PaaS when it fits; add AKS only with ops capacity.
  • Budgets + Advisor weekly in every subscription.
  • Document how to delete the lab in README.

11. Common mistakes

  • Creating resources in the wrong subscription or region.
  • Leaving App Service plans, SQL, or AKS running after the lab.
  • Putting passwords in Git or screenshots shared on chat.
  • Skipping a smoke test URL/health check after deploy.
